Salisbury, MD (November 13, 2024) – Emergency responders from the Salisbury Fire Department (Station 1) were dispatched to the 1000 block of S. Salisbury Boulevard on Wednesday following reports of a motor vehicle accident with injuries. The incident involved multiple parties and caused disruptions in the busy area.
Paramedics provided medical attention to the injured at the scene, while firefighters worked to secure the area and assist with traffic control. The extent of injuries sustained by the individuals involved has not yet been confirmed. Local authorities are investigating the circumstances surrounding the crash and have urged motorists to exercise caution in the area.
